Hi, I’m Alyssa!

I am a writer, speaker, artist and disabilities advocate.

Living with a chronic, progressive nerve disorder has presented unique and unprecedented challenges in my life since I was a child.

Everyday tasks require extraordinary effort, but learning to live with these daily difficulties year after year has taught me how to trust God’s limitless grace within the limitations of my disability.

My heart is to encourage and empower others to embrace their unique differences and share their gifts and talents with the world.

My hope is to share meaningful messages through writing, art and videos to bring a shift in perspective about physical and emotional hardship.

Doubtless: Walking By Faith, Not By Sight (PRE-ORDER)

Alyssa Kumle enjoyed all the pastimes of a typical American childhood—twirling in tutus at ballet lessons, scoring goals in soccer games, diving off blocks at swim meets, and jumping on her trampoline.

But soon into elementary school, she suddenly found herself unable to participate in basic physical activities. She began to trip while jumping rope, struggled to stay standing while roller blading, and couldn't keep up with the other kids at recess. Her P.E. teacher finally called her parents and told them she believed something was wrong and to get her checked out.

At the age of 8, her worst fears were confirmed: she discovered she had a neurological disease and would grow increasingly weaker to the point of becoming physically disabled and restricting her mobility to the use of leg braces and a walker or a wheelchair.

Now, as a young woman in her mid-20's, Alyssa recounts her story of defeating the doubt that entered her life the moment she received the dismal diagnosis that would change her life forever.

Join Alyssa on an awe-inspiring journey of overcoming fear, loss, anxiety, depression, self-hatred, and so much more through the power of Jesus Christ.
